Trying to change any binds while the “set bindings for” mode is set to “controller” and without having a controller plugged in will softlock the game.

Remapping

These keys cannot be rebound from these controls. Additionally, these keys also cannot be bound: F1F12, Pause, ~, =, ← Backspace, Caps Lock, RAlt, Menu, and all numpad keys.
Bind Key
Pause / menu back Esc
Inventory / skip cutscene Tab
Swap to Ruby 1
Swap to Weiss 2
Swap to Blake 3
Swap to Yang 4
Reload last save F5
These keys are hardcoded to these controls separately from the customizable key binds. While they can be bound to other functions, this will result in these keys performing both functions, which may be undesirable (e.g. with S bound to “Jump”, S will make the character jump, but it will also make them crouch if held when landing on the ground).
